Shopify is a household name in the e-commerce market, taking pleasure in prevalent recognition as the leading software vendor internationally. Established in 2006 by entrepreneur Tobias Lütke, the company was born out of an individual struggle to develop an online store for snowboarding gear. Determined to simplify the process, Lütke shifted his focus from constructing an online shop to supplying superior tools for retailers seeking to develop their own e-commerce platforms.
‘s e-commerce software has actually delighted in paralleled growth and garnered countless clients across the world. By 2016, the company had almost $400 million in annual income, and that figure exploded to $4.6 billion by 2021 after the Covid pandemic spurred an online retail boom.
forayed into point-of-sale systems in 2017 by launching a Bluetooth-enabled debit and charge card reader for brick-and-mortar shops. Given that then, it has constructed more products and turned them into a significant source of profits. The business is based in Ottawa, Canada.

e-commerce plans:
$ 29 for Standard when billed every year (or $39 when paid monthly).
$ 79 for routine when billed yearly (or $105 when paid monthly).
$ 299 for Advanced when billed each year (or $399 when paid monthly).
Customized rates for Shopify Plus.
All e-commerce prepares featured POS Lite for offering in-person. Upgrading to Pro for brick-and-mortar businesses costs an additional $89 per place.
‘s alternative solutions for generally offering in-person:
$ 5 for Starter plan, which consists of one Lite area.
$ 79 (when billed each year) for Retail strategy, or $89 when paid monthly; consists of one Pro place.
How Much Does a POS System Cost?
Hardware expense
$ 49 for Tap & Chip card reader.
$ 219 for Tap & Chip countertop package (iPad not consisted of).
$ 299 for Go mobile phone.
$ 349 for terminal.
$ 459 and up for terminal counter top kits.
Contract length
No contract needed. Strategies are paid month to month unless you register for an annual, two-year or three-year strategy.

Shopify Payments
offers a payments processing service that lets you charge cash to all major debit and charge card. Your clients can insert their cards, tap them, or swipe them depending upon the kind of hardware you chose. There’s likewise Tap to Pay, which lets you accept payments on your iPhone with no additional hardware. The rates is transparent– between 2.4% and 2.7% on each successful deal– without any hidden costs or setup fees.
